Apple Event: May 7th at 7 am PT

Looks like no one’s replied in a while. To start the conversation again, simply ask a new question.

HomeKit Geofence only works with Home location now

For years I’ve used HomeKit during the winter months to turn the thermostat down “When the Last Person Leaves Home” and put it back to the comfort setting “When the First Person Arrives Home”. Occasionally I would use a custom automation to set the thermostat back to the comfort setting when leaving a location, ie a restaurant, by entering its address in place of “Home”. That way the house had extra time to warm back up.


This winter, the arrive/leave Home automations still work but a custom location doesn’t. To eliminate the thermostat I’ve tried turning a light on when leaving a location without success. To eliminate my phone I set up an automation on my wife’s phone that didn’t work. Today, to eliminate cellular data I turned off Wi-Fi, set up separate automations to turn one light on when I left home and turn another one on when I arrived. They both worked as did the thermostat automations.


It seems something is broken with iOS 15 where custom locations in HomeKit no longer work. What I’ve noticed is different between setting up the location automations is that for the Home location, it permits any or all of the people included in that Home to trigger the automation whereas for a custom location, only the person the phone is associated with can trigger the automation. I don’t recall if this was the case before.


Has anyone else had this issue and found a fix?

Posted on Dec 9, 2021 10:57 AM

Reply
Question marked as Best reply

Posted on Dec 28, 2021 12:10 PM

Had the automation set to a new address and was there for only five minutes. The light was turned on at home when I got there, so it seems the geofence is now working for addresses other than Home. What has changed is not clear. I did send feedback to Apple and maybe it’s something they needed to set on their side? 🤷🏻

4 replies
Question marked as Best reply

Dec 28, 2021 12:10 PM in response to Recreational Mac User

Had the automation set to a new address and was there for only five minutes. The light was turned on at home when I got there, so it seems the geofence is now working for addresses other than Home. What has changed is not clear. I did send feedback to Apple and maybe it’s something they needed to set on their side? 🤷🏻

Dec 21, 2021 11:45 AM in response to Recreational Mac User

I’ve continued the set an address to trigger an automation to turn on a light at home when I leave, and today it worked. The difference from other occasions when it has failed to work is I was at the address for over two hours. Maybe it’s time related? Hoping iOS 15.3 will return this geofence option to pre iOS 15 functionality.

HomeKit Geofence only works with Home location now

Welcome to Apple Support Community
A forum where Apple customers help each other with their products. Get started with your Apple ID.